Tamar Beruchashvili

Date and Place of Birth

April 9, 1961, Tbilisi, Georgia

Professional Experience 

11/2022 - present - Ambassador of Georgia to Romania 

08/2021 - 10/2022 - Special representative of the topics pertaining to the Black Sea

04/2020 - 05/2021 - Permanent Representative of Georgia to IMO (International Maritime Organization)

04/2016 - 04/2020 - Ambassador of Georgia to the United Kingdom. Permanent Representative of Georgia to IMO (International Maritime Organization)

11/2014 - 09/2015 – Minister of Foreign Affairs of Georgia

04/2013 - 11/2014 –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s of Georgia

10/2012 - 3/2013 – Deputy State Minister of Georgia on European and Euro-Atlantic Integration

01/2011 - 10/2012 – Chief Adviser to the Vice Prime Minister, State Minister of Georgia on European and Euro-Atlantic Integration 

12/2004 - 01/2011 – First Deputy State Minister of Georgia on European and Euro-Atlantic Integration

02/2004 - 12/2004 – State Minister of Georgia on European Integration

12/2003 - 02/2004 – Deputy State Minister, State Chancellery of Georgia

06/2000 - 12/2003 –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s of Georgia

1998 - 2000 – Minister of Trade and Foreign Economic Relations of Georgia

06/1998 - 08/1998 – Deputy Minister of Trade and Foreign Economic Relations of Georgia

05/1997 - 08/1997 – Analyst, Dr. Zbigniew Brzezinski Office, Washington D.C., U.S.

1994 - 1996 – Deputy Executive Director, TACIS Coordination Bureau, Ministry of Science and Technology of Georgia

1992 - 1994 – Administrator, TACIS Coordination Bureau, State Committee of Foreign Economic Relations of Georgia

1990 - 1992 – Chief Specialist, International Co-operation Department, Ministry of Science and Technology of Georgia

1986 - 1990 – Research Fellow, I. Kutateladze Institute of Pharmacochemistry of the Georgian National Academy of Sciences

EDUCATION

2002 - 2006 – Postgraduate Study, Qualification - PhD in Economics, Faculty of Economics; Iv. Javakhishvili Tbilisi State University

2002 - 2006 – Professional Training - Commercial Diplomacy; Carleton University, Ottawa, Canada

1996 - 1998  - Master of Public Affairs (MPA), the Comparative and International Affairs Programme; Indiana University Bloomington, U.S.

1992 - 1993 – Professional Training - European Studies and the English Language University of Limerick, Ireland

1991 - 1992 – Professional Training - Management, International Relations; UNESCO International Centre for Management, Tbilisi, Georgia

1978 - 1985 – Faculty of Physics and Mathematics and Natural Sciences; Faculty of Foreign Languages (French); Moscow Patrice Lumumba People's Friendship University; Qualification - Chemist-analyst; Teacher of Secondary and Higher Educational Institutions; Interpreter

SCIENTIFIC / ACADEMIC EXPERIENCE

24/01/2011 – Associate Professor; Ilia State University

2007 - 2010 – Visiting Professor, Course for the Master's Degree - European Neighbourhood Policy; Institute of European Studies; Iv. Javakhishvili Tbilisi State University

2006 - 2009 – Professor, Course for the Master's Degree - International Trade and Development; Georgian Institute of Public Affairs (GIPA)

04/2007 - 03/2008 – Visiting Professor, Master's Degree Programme, Course of lectures - EU assistance policy: Georgia's experience; European Studies Centre, Grenoble University, France

2000 - 2009 – Visiting Professor, Course for the Master's Degree - Commercial Diplomacy and International Trade Policy, Economics and Business Department; Iv. Javakhishvili Tbilisi State University 

2006 – Defended a thesis and was granted PhD in economics

Accomplishments

2000 –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ary

03/2006 – "Open Society" Foundation grant for survey of public opinion on European priorities.

06/2002 – U.S. State Department award for Edmund Muskie scholarship program "Freedom Support Act"

04/2000 – President of Georgia’s commendation for contribution made to the process of Georgia's accession to the WTO

05/1996 – U.S. Government Edmund Muskie Scholarship Programme "Freedom Support Act"

Member of the American Society of Public Administration; Member of the Georgian Information Society; Board Member of International Trade Policy and Law Centre; Board Member of GIPA; Board Member of the Centre for European Integration Studies; Member of Indiana University Alumni Association; Member of the Georgian Edmund Muskie Scholarship Program Alumni Association
